- PLAN FIRST
Being a professional, you must know the importance of planning. You cannot outshine in your career without sound planning. The first and foremost step you have to take is, think about where you stand right now. Then, begin planning what you can do and how you can become a pro in your field. You can make a list of all these tasks as well. Once you have planned everything, do not forget to break it down into smaller objectives.

- SET PRACTICAL AND SMALL GOALS
One of the most common mistakes that people commit is that they set big, unachievable, and sometimes illogical goals. Remember, your goals must be achievable and practical so that you enjoy struggling for them. Otherwise, you will overwhelm yourself, and you can affect your productivity.
During your planning phase, you can set milestones, and smaller and easily achievable goals so that you can passionately work on them.
- SELF-CONTEMPLATION IS VITAL
No matter where you stand in your career path, never forget to analyze yourself. Take out a day in a week and ruminate on what you have done so far. It will also guide you towards accomplishing a new task, or you might feel the need to acquire a new skill.
To make this a little more interesting, you can gift yourself on being more productive. For example, you can promise yourself a day at the spa if you have spent an entire week productively and proficiently.
